In the picturesque area of the city of Totma, in the Zelenka fishing settlement, known since 1499, under the hill named Fetikha, at the mouth of the river Pyosya Denga and the bay of the Sukhona, stands the Trinity Church. The church was built from 1768 to 1788. The longest wooden bridge in the Vologda region leads from the city center to it. The Trinity Church is a monument of architecture in the unique style of Totma Baroque. Locals compare the slender and upward-reaching white church to a sailing ship and a white swan. The church was built with the funds of merchant and navigator Stepan Cherepanov, as well as grateful residents who wished to leave a mark in the history of their homeland.
